Output 24fd4b052816ec40b5bc69bc1d69dee3e60262947a576097e2ba2f16d78b9865:0

value
6697131
script pubkey
OP_HASH160 OP_PUSHBYTES_20 291a087a9c7fef9ae9820f04f7af1d7bbd50a72a OP_EQUAL
address
35SLpDpE6P6yuEApXWafqgDbkNrUBE6XgF
transaction
24fd4b052816ec40b5bc69bc1d69dee3e60262947a576097e2ba2f16d78b9865
spent
true